John Spotts Wright

BirthMarch 31, 1852 - Burnside, Clearfield County, Pennsylvania, United States of America
DeathJan. 20, 1938 - Indiana County, Pennsylvania, United States of America
MotherElizabeth Sarah Spotts
FatherWilliam Wright

Born in Burnside, Clearfield County, Pennsylvania, United States of America on March 31, 1852 to William Wright and Elizabeth Sarah Spotts. John Spotts Wright married Anna Elizabeth Best and had 10 children. He passed away on Jan. 20, 1938 in Indiana County, Pennsylvania, United States of America.
